A PALS Permit ($18) is required to access these lands. Hunting is not allowed on 9 State Forests some with Deed Restrictions such as Crawford State Forest, Niday Place State Forest & Bourassa State Forest, and others with access limitations for the public such South Quay State Forest, Old Flat State Forest & Hawks State Forest, and some with such high public use that safety is a concern such as Zoar State Forest, Chesterfield State Forest, and Paul State Forest. Temporary dispersed primitive camping (no water, electric hookups, bathrooms or other facilities) is allowed at many of the Departments WMAs across the Commonwealth, when occupants are engaged in authorized activities.
